Understanding ADHD in Adults
ADHD is identified by a consistent pattern of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ity. While the symptoms of ADHD are often identified in youth, lots of adults remain undiagnosed, causing distress and challenges in numerous domains of life, including work, relationships, and social settings.
Common symptoms in adults may include:
- Disorganization and issues prioritizing tasks.
- Difficulty sustaining attention in tasks or activities.
- Impulsivity and problem with self-control.
- Issues with time management and meeting deadlines.
- Chronic boredom and uneasyness.
The Importance of Diagnosis
A diagnosis of ADHD can offer clearness for adults who have actually long fought with numerous difficulties without understanding the underlying cause. Correct diagnosis can result in reliable management techniques that improve daily functioning and total quality of life.
The Diagnosis Process in Private Clinics
1. Preliminary Consultation
The journey often starts with establishing a preliminary assessment with a private center that concentrates on ADHD. Throughout this assessment, the clinician will collect info concerning the person's symptoms, case history, and any pertinent household history.
2. Comprehensive Assessment
Following the preliminary assessment, a thorough assessment is typically performed. This might include:
- Clinical Interviews: In-depth conversations that provide insights into the person's behavioral patterns and obstacles.
- Standardized Questionnaires: Tools like the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) or other verified assessments that assist evaluate the seriousness and impact of symptoms.
- Security Information: Gathering information from family members or better halves, when suitable, can provide extra context to the clinician.
3. Diagnostic Criteria
Clinicians utilize diagnostic requirements described in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5) to make a diagnosis. The requirements need that signs should exist in several settings (e.g., work, home) and must hinder social, academic, or occupational performance.
4. Feedback Session
When the assessment is complete, a feedback session is arranged, where clinicians share their findings and talk about the diagnosis, treatment options, and possible strategies for management.
5. Treatment Planning
If identified with ADHD, a personalized treatment strategy can be established, which may include a mix of medication, psychiatric therapy, training, and way of life modifications.

FAQs About ADHD Diagnosis for Adults in the UK
1. How much does a private ADHD assessment cost in the UK?
The cost of a private adhd test private assessment can range from ₤ 300 to over ₤ 1,000, depending on the center and the comprehensiveness of the assessment.
2. For how long does the diagnosis process take?
The process may vary extensively. An initial consultation can frequently be set up within a few weeks, while the complete assessment and diagnosis can take several weeks to months depending on the center's procedures.
3. Exist treatment alternatives readily available once identified?
Yes, treatment alternatives can consist of medication, cognitive behavior modification (CBT), training, and way of life changes, customized to the individual's needs.
4. What credentials should I look for in a clinician?
Look for clinicians who are certified psychological health experts with specific experience in identifying and treating ADHD in adults. This might include psychiatrists, psychologists, or specialized nurse practitioners.
5. Can ADHD be diagnosed later in life, even if symptoms were present in youth?
Yes, adults who were not diagnosed as kids can still receive a valid diagnosis in later life if they display relentless signs that meet the diagnostic requirements.
